Motorsport Products Pro ATV X-Stand

Mar. 01, 2003 By Dean Waters
The Pro ATV X-stand has already proven to be one of the most useful products that we have come across in a while. We have been using the Motorsport Products Pro ATV X-Stand for about 3 months now. The stand has become a must have for working on our project ATV's. Up until this point we had made do and spent allot of time bending over or crawling around the garage floor while working on the quads. Now with the Pro ATV stand we can easily get the quad up to working level and have been able to save our back and knees. It has made teardowns and general repairs so much more convenient with the ATV at a decent working height. Most of the dealers and shops have nice hoists or lifts but not everyone can afford a lift. For $109.95 you can have your own stand at home.

The three ratcheting straps for attaching the stand to your ATV also hold the stand together when folded for transport or storage.
The Pro ATV X-stand is made from high quality 6061 aluminum and it comes with three adjustable ratchet tie downs with rubber coated hooks. The front of the stand has a large panel that can accommodate all of your sponsor logos or your name and number. The complete stand is very light and folds up nicely so that you can take it to the race track with you. The stand comes in blue, red, green, black, and semi-chrome so no matter what brand you ride there is one to match. There is no assembly required for the stand itself but if you have a belly plate on your ATV and want to use the stand with the belly plate installed you may have to slot the plate to allow the billet frame hooks access to your ATV's frame. We stood Project Raptor up on end then held the stand up and marked the spots for the slots. We then removed the belly plate and cut a slot on each side with our sawzall. With the new slots in our belly plate we reassembled the belly plate and we were ready for installation on our stand.
We marked spots on the skid plate where we wanted the stand attached to the frame.

The hardest part of using the stand is actually lifting the front of the ATV up so as to stand it on end on the rear grab bar. If you can do that by yourself then it is all a one man operation. After that you simply put the stand up to the frame. Run one strap to the forward part of your frame and one out each side to your pegs. Ratchet these down evenly then you let the front of the ATV back towards the ground. The feet on the stand are made such that they make contact then allow the stand to be rolled forward and onto the front two legs. That is it. You are now ready to work on your ATV.

Summary We have found the Pro ATV X-stand to be VERY functional and useful. Not only does it work good in the garage at home it works great for displaying your quad at the track or for making those last minute adjustments. If you are a racer or sport quad owner and find yourself working on your quad quite often then we think this stand makes an excellent addition to your arsenal of tools and equipment. We also really like the Pro ATV X-Stand for displaying the ATV at the race track.
